做作业时需要c语言连接mysql数据库遇到了相当神奇的错误,好在在大神同学的帮助下解决了,,首先根据网上的教程在属性配置-C/C++-常规-附加包含目录中输入include文件夹路径,在属性配置-链接器-常规-附加目录输入lib所在的文件夹在链接器-输入-附加依赖项中添加lib文件路径,出现报错现象无法打开文件C:/Program Files/MySQL/MySQL Sever 5.7/lib.
SQL语言的特点:(1)SQL是一种类似于英语的语言,语法简单。(2)SQL是一种一体化语言,包括数据定义、数据查询、数据操作和数据控制等多方面的功能。(3)SQL是一种非过程化的语言,用户不需要关心具体的操作过程。(4)SQL是一种面向集合的语言,每个命令的操作对象是一个或多个关系,结果也是一个关系。(5)SQL既是自含式语言,又是嵌入式语言。(6)SQL具有数据查询、数据定义、数据操纵和数据
# C语言SQL Server数据库 ## 1. 概述 C语言是一种通用的程序设计语言,广泛用于系统软件开发。SQL Server是微软公司推出的关系型数据库管理系统。在实际的软件开发中,经常需要使用C语言SQL Server数据库进行交互,以实现数据的存取操作。 本文将介绍如何在C语言中连接SQL Server数据库,并进行数据的增删改查操作。我们将以一个简单的学生信息管理系统为例,演
原创 2024-04-01 04:19:28
168阅读
数据库进行查询和修改操作的语言叫做 SQL (Structured Query Language,结构化查询语言)。SQL 语言是目前广泛使用的关系数据库标准语言,是各种数据库交互方式的基础。SQL 是一种数据库查询和程序设计语言,用于存取数据以及查询、更新和管理关系数据库系统。与其他程序设计语言(如 C语言、Java 等)不同的是,SQL 由很少的关键字组成,每个 SQL 语句通过一个或多个关
转载 2024-01-15 21:35:53
129阅读
工具:1.Visual Studio 20192.SQL Server数据库(我使用的2008)操作:1.打开SQL Server,打开后会看到数据库的初始链接界面。(如下图)2..复制上图中的“服务器名称”,然后点击“连接”,进入数据库。3.打开vs,创建好自己要用的项目,我写的项目名称叫做:‘finnal_test’,要做的是数据库综合实习关于奖学金评定的管理系统4.工具->连接到数据库
1.使用C语言来操作SQL SERVER数据库,采用ODBC开放式数据库连接进行数据的添加,修改,删除,查询等操作。 step1:启动SQLSERVER服务,例如:HNHJ,开始菜单 ->运行 ->net start mssqlserver step2:打开企业管理器,建立数据库test,在test中建立test表(a varchar(200),b varchar(200))
转载 2024-08-27 14:09:36
132阅读
如果一个ODBC API函数执行成功,则返回SQL_SUCCESS或SQL_SUCCESS_WITH_INFO,SQL_SUCCESS指示可通过诊断记录获取有关操作的详细信息,SQL_SUCCESS_WITH_INFO指示应用程序执行结果带有警告信息,可通过诊断记录获取详细信息。如果函数调用失败,返回码为SQL_ERROR。SQLAllocHandle(SQL_HANDLE_ENV,SQL_N
转载 2024-04-26 11:27:39
237阅读
简述利用 sql plus 工具可以进行哪些数据库管理与开发首先,sql server 2005的安装并不复杂从你的追问来看,如果只是简单的数据操作而且数据量不大,你可以干脆用类似的连接方法连access文件做数据库就好了,office就全带了,也不必安装数据库引擎和管理工具(数据存储本身并不拘泥于数据库,存成excel和text文档也未尝不可)当然,这些都取决于项目的规模,性质等因素了如果你的数
事实上对于操作sqlite的其他语言,写一个统一的数据库操作模型是非常容易的,比如java,c#,这些语言支持垃圾回收,支持异常捕获,支持泛型,写起来就很容易。但是对于C语言,就得另当别论了,就拿查询操作来说,c语言没有泛型,不能返回统一的泛型列表,只能返回数据模型的链表结构。但是得益于前面讲过的通用链表)结构,我们可以尽可能的像其他语言一样封装一个通用的数据库操作模型。回顾前面讲到的sqlite
转载 2024-01-12 17:21:02
49阅读
连接到SAMPL数据库,查询LASTNAM为JOHNSO的FIRSTNAM信息。#i nclude #include #include #include"util.h" #include EXEC SQL INCLUDE SQLCA;(1) main() { EXEC SQL BEGIN DECLARE SECTION;(2) char firstname[13]; char userid[9];
http://andrew913.iteye.com/blog/433280用C语言数据库操作还真不多,一般都选择文件操作来搞定。 最近一个项目需要用到MYSQL,就去看了下mysql之c api. 基本上都是一样的,说白了就是一个应用层的协议。正因为做的机会不多,所以要写下来,免得以后忘记了。1.首先当然是连接,函数原型如下: C代码 1. MYSQL * STD
**C语言连接MySQL数据库编程教程**一、下载安装mysql.h文件我们使用的编译器一般为VC6.0或者VS,默认的都是32位编译器,所以我们下载的文件也直接下载32位的就可以。下面附上下载地址:https://downloads.mysql.com/archives/c-c/选择32位的下载 下载后解压到桌面上备用,我们用到的文件为include和lib,这个时候第一步就算完成了二、选择
本文目录一、变量二、类型修饰符三、不同编译器环境下基本数据类型的存储长度本文转载自 @m了个jC语言有丰富的数据类型,因此它很适合用来编写数据库,如DB2、Oracle都是C语言写的。C语言数据类型大致可以分为下图中的几类: 一、变量跟其他语言一样,C语言中用变量来存储计算过程使用的值,任何变量都必须先定义类型再使用。为什么一定要先定义呢?因为变量的类型决定了变量占用的存储空间,所以定
一、C语言数据类型  ok,如我们所知,C语言作为大学工科专业的必学课程,其重要性不言而喻;它为我们提供了丰富的数据类型,所以它很适合程序员来编写 数据库 ,如DB2、Oracale都是C语言编写的。  那么C语言具体又有哪些类型呢?且看如下分解:    1.基本数据类型      1)整型 int (long int , long long int)      2)浮点型       
数据编程基础知识,掌握C语言,熟悉简单的SQL语句,能够实现简单的增、删、查、改即INSERT、DELETE 、SELECT、UPDATE语句,其中SELECT语句尤为重要,面试笔试中经常被问及。默认都懂的SQL语言,mysql数据库在不同的系统下包含的头文件也不同windows下加以下头文件:#include<windows.h>//因为数据库通信用的socket技术 #i
转载 2023-12-07 09:11:07
153阅读
# SQL Server链接数据库的完整指南 在现代应用开发中,数据库连接是一个至关重要的环节。今天,我们将学习如何在SQL Server中连接到其他数据库。本文将通过一个清晰的流程来指导初学者,并提供相应的代码示例和必要的注释。 ## 流程概述 我们将使用以下表格展示链接数据库的基本步骤: | 步骤编号 | 步骤描述 | 预计完成时间 | | -
原创 2024-09-22 06:05:40
36阅读
# SQL Server数据库链接 ## 什么是SQL Server数据库链接SQL Server数据库链接是指在SQL Server数据库中建立与其他数据库或服务器之间的连接,以便在这些数据库之间进行数据交换或共享。通过数据库链接,用户可以在不同的数据库之间进行数据的查询、插入、更新和删除操作,实现数据的共享和协作。 ## SQL Server数据库链接的应用场景 SQL Serve
原创 2024-02-26 06:38:04
45阅读
# 连接 SQL Server 数据库的步骤 ## 流程图示意 ```mermaid stateDiagram [*] --> 初始化 初始化 --> 连接数据库 连接数据库 --> 查询数据 查询数据 --> [*] ``` ## 步骤 | 步骤 | 操作 | 代码示例
原创 2024-06-25 04:56:46
94阅读
C语言调用sqlite3数据库前言一、直接操作 sqlite3_exec( ) 函数二、使用 sqlite3_prepare_v2( ), sqlite3_bind_text(), sqlite3_step( ) 分步调用总结 前言sqlite3是文件型数据库, 小巧, 快, 环境构建容易. 本文介绍sqlite3最基本的C语言API, 有相关需求的人可以看看.一、直接操作 sqlite3_e
转载 2024-03-17 22:48:59
591阅读
环境:visual studio前提:已经安装 mysql,并且成功连接,知道用户名(通常是root)、密码23/5/24 更新:一个基于 c 语言、mysql 的小型示例学生管理系统资源路径:文档资源 项目代码:代码仓库 一、配置环境创建 控制台应用程序(空项目)新建项,创建conn.c 源文件右击项目名称,点击属性找到 VC++ ,修改:包含目录和目录 分别添加 mysql安装路径下的inc
转载 2023-05-26 20:33:12
120阅读
1点赞
  • 1
  • 2
  • 3
  • 4
  • 5